Finance Review — Q2 Budget Request, Regional Branches. Thanks for getting your submissions in early this cycle. Overall asks came in about 6% above envelope, mostly driven by the Larkfield fit-out and extra staffing at the Penhallow branch. We've approved the fit-out in full, trimmed travel lines by 10% across the board, and deferred the signage refresh to Q3. Marketing co-op funds stay flat. Nothing dramatic, but please sanity-check your revised numbers before month-end. The thinking behind these calls is summarised in the note below.

confidential, kagup-bafog: Fraaxax Group is in early talks to buy Soroxox Group for about $343.8 million. The Olidor launch date is June 14, and nothing goes to the press before then. Legal wants the Aldmirek Logistics term sheet signed before July 23.

Key Ceremony Checklist — Item 7: RateLens Parity Checker. Before sealing the signing keys for the RateLens hotel rate-parity service, confirm that the comparison engine's signing module has been rebuilt from the audited tag and that both ceremony witnesses from the Varnholt office have initialed the build log. Verify the scraper credential vault is offline for the duration. Once the reviewer countersigns, record the recovery passphrase exactly as spoken by the custodian below.

vault phrase of taweg-kafof = oliax-zorael

**Ticket PKT-88: Webhook fires twice on parcel handoff**

For whoever inherits this: the Cartwheel parcel-tracking webhook double-fires when a package moves from the Delven hub to a courier within the same minute. Downstream, Merrow's notifier then texts customers twice. Root cause looks like a missing idempotency check in the handoff event coalescer. Repro steps attached. The offending deploy is identified by the token below.

trace token, hawep-hadug: htk3_9c2